 
                
                    Here's a few sketches I did a year ago (or longer); I'm finally putting them together on one image while I finish recuperating.
This image features her facial appearance as it ranges from her perceived age of 3 all the way to her getting-close-to-kicking-the-bucket-age of 3,072. The larger number beside these ages is the approximate time span in our years.
Over time, as a succubus or incubus ages, they end up trading beauty for power. The Elders who punished her were pretty rough looking, so it's quite possible they were somewhere in the 2,000-2,500 year range (500,000 to 625,000 years).
Penance's current age is around 20 (5,000) years old. While she can assume her future (or past) forms, she cannot demonstrate the power of those forms until she has actually reached those ages and acquired that power. But there's nothing wrong with using that hideous appearance to scare the crap out of someone!

The easiest way to visually describe the situation would be like this: Penance would normally exist in a reality outside our own, and her actual physical form would never be seen by someone who did not exist in the same realm as she did. Since she would normally appear to her victims in their dreams, she would resemble whatever form they most desired. But now that she is physically stuck in an alien form (the bear), she doesn't have the option of changing her appearance unless it's all in her victim's head.
So, for example, if she was somehow back in her native world 500,000 years from now, and looked like that last profile picture in the above submission (in her physical reality), she could still appear as the younger version of herself or anyone else in a victim's dreams. She could also resume her former physical appearances, much like the way she can appear as the older, uglier version of herself (as seen in "Dead Bitch"). The only difference would be the amount of power she wields. She could change her appearance (in her native world) to look like she's ancient, but she would only have the power that she currently has at her present physical age. Conversely, when she is ancient, she could change her appearance to look like she's in her twenties again, yet this time, she would have the power of her ancient demon form.
